Coal — Methods for petrographic analysis — Part 4: Method of determining microlithotype, carbominerite and minerite composition

SKU: cf96c75c7ac3 Category:

Description

This document specifies a method, using a graticule with 20 crossline intersections, for determining the proportions of microlithotypes, carbominerite and minerite in coals. It applies only to determinations made on polished particulate blocks using reflected white light. Additional blue, blue-violet or UV light excitation for better identification of liptinite in fluorescence can be used especially for low rank coals.
